INTRODUCTION OF DERMIGEN NF 15GM CREAM
Dermigen NF Cream is a medication that combines multiple drugs to treat various skin infections. It effectively reduces inflammation symptoms such as redness, swelling, and itching while also providing antimicrobial action against infection-causing microorganisms.

It is essential to use Dermigen NF Cream externally as directed by your physician. Apply a thin layer of the medication only to the affected skin areas with clean and dry hands. In case it comes into contact with your eyes, nose, mouth, or vagina, rinse it with water. Although it may take several days to weeks for your symptoms to improve, it is necessary to use this medication regularly. To ensure better efficacy of the medicine, complete the entire course of treatment. Consult your doctor if your condition does not improve or worsens.

Dermigen NF Cream is generally safe to use, but you may experience irritation, redness, or burning sensation at the application site. If these side effects persist, contact your doctor. Applying moisturizer regularly to your skin can help prevent dryness. 

It is unlikely that other orally or injectable medications will interfere with the efficacy of Dermigen NF Cream, but if you have previously experienced an allergic reaction to similar medication, talk to your doctor before using it. Additionally, inform your doctor if you are pregnant, planning to become pregnant, or breastfeeding.

BENEFITS OF DERMIGEN NF 15GM CREAM
Dermigen NF Cream is used to treat skin infections caused by microorganisms including bacteria and fungi. It kills and inhibits the growth of infection-causing germs, eliminating the infection and alleviating symptoms. It also prevents the release of chemicals that cause itching, redness, and swelling. As a result, this medication reduces the inflammation caused by these infections.

You should continue to take this medication even if your symptoms go away; otherwise, they may return. This could take many weeks depending on the type of infection. Even if your illness is entirely treated, you may need to use it on a regular basis to keep the symptoms at bay.
